Sentry Open-Sources Skillet to Help AI Coding Agents Author and Evaluate Skills
zeeg · x · 2026-07-31
Sentry has open-sourced Skillet, a tool designed to help developers build and refine skills for AI coding agents more effectively.
- How it works: Developers describe their requirements in plain language, and Skillet automatically drafts the behavior spec, generates corresponding instructions, and writes eval test cases.
- Core philosophy: Similar to OpenSpec, it focuses on codifying intent and evals to systematically improve the performance and reliability of agent skills.
- Usage: It can be quickly initialized via the command line and seamlessly integrated into existing coding agent workflows.
